Here is the issue: You can either set a payment term OR a payment method. A payment term will drive an customer invoice, where a payment method (visa, mastercard, etc) will drive a payment to be authorized (or processed, depending upon your setting). The base price level will always default if the price level is not set on the customer level. If you have renamed the base price, look for the price level (setup>accounting> accounting lists>price level) with the internal id = 1 ~angela

System notes on all records within NetSuite are driven by the employee record. I'm not sure what 'Personal Information' you'd like removed, but the option to hide the 'notes' subtab will remove the system notes from being seen. Note that accounting may not like you removing them. Just a thought. ~angela

On the item records, the 'description' field that drives the BOM is 'stock description'. If you don't have this defined on the Assembly Components, it won't print on the BOM. ~angela

If you're using average costing, your costing engine will 'recalculate'. Inventory worksheets actually trigger the average costing engine to reset the calculations. Work Order Close is an actual record. When the work order is marked as closed, there is a GL impact that clears the WIP accounts and posts to the new item value, depending on your costing method used.

Ah! Yes, when using work order WIP & Routing, there is a step required of creating a work order close record. These types of work orders must be closed, they are not marked as built. ~angela

Lot numbering costing method allows each lot you create/receive to have the specific cost of that lot assigned. It is not the same as 'FIFO' costing.
